The Crucible
Arthur Miller's dramatic and powerful play. Set in 1692, the real events of the Salem Witch Trials are woven into this evocative story of passion, jealousy, betrayal and hysteria.
When the play was first produced in 1953 it was seen as a political allegory to the McCarthy 'witch hunt' against communist sympathisers in the USA. Sixty years on it still resonates with contemporary issues of fear, paranoia and obsessive relationships.
Now a popular set text in schools, the story and characters are still as intriguing and memorable to audiences of every age.
